A history teacher is writing a test worth 100 points. She uses multiple-choice questions worth 6 points each and true/false questions worth 2 points each. She wants the test to have three times as many
multiple-choice questions as true/false questions. Let m represent the number of multiple-choice
questions on the test, and let t represent the number of true/false questions. Which system of
equations can be used to find how many of each type of question she should write?
6m + 2t = 100
m = 36
3m + t = 100
m = 3t
6m + 2t = 100
t = 3m
6m + 2t = 100
m=t+3
